Subject: clock skew cut-over — done (mostly)

Hey Priya,

Quick recap before you review the PR: we moved all Brindlecore build agents to the new time-sync daemon last night. Skew between agents is now under 40ms, so the flaky cache-invalidation tests should stop lying to us. Two older agents still run the shim; they retire Friday. The daemon ships with the settings listed just below.

settings of bawif-fawif:
ralix:
  log_level: warn
  metrics_host: metrics.ralix.tolvaqsys.internal
  pool_size: 32

Hi Doran,

Handover for the Vigilquill proctoring queue: backlog cleared around 02:00, but the retry worker is still flaky — it occasionally re-enqueues completed exam sessions. I've enabled dedupe logging so you can trace any duplicates. Please check the queue-depth graph every two hours and pause intake if it exceeds 5,000. For anything beyond restarts, the platform team should be looped in.

billing contact of tahaf-kafop = istwyn_fraox@norvaworks.corp

## Artifact Signing — ScanBridge Integration

ScanBridge builds (the barcode scanner module for WarePoint) are signed at CI stage `sign-artifacts`. Do not sign locally. The pipeline pulls the firmware blob, hashes it, and attaches the signature to the release manifest. Verification runs on every handheld unit at boot; an unsigned build bricks the scanner UI until reflashed. Rotate the key quarterly per the Tollgate policy doc. If verification fails in staging, check clock drift on the signer VM first. The current public signing key is below.

rollout seal: bky4_x7Gc

// Session-token refresh bug context (Brindlewick auth service):
// Under concurrent requests, two workers could both detect an expiring
// token and issue duplicate refreshes, invalidating each other's grant.
// Users on the Faldor mobile client saw forced logouts roughly every
// 40 minutes. We now refresh behind a mutex with a jittered early-renewal
// window so only one worker wins. The constants below control that
// window and the retry backoff; tune them together, not separately.

limits module of fajog-tawig:
RATE_LIMITS = {
    "druwyn": 2,
    "quenael": 10,
    "wenix": 2,
    "druael": 2,
}